X-ray spectroscopy

X-ray spectroscopy is a general term for several spectroscopic techniques for characterization of materials by using x-ray radiation. == Characteristic X-ray spectroscopy == When an electron from the inner shell of an atom is excited by the energy of a photon, it moves to a higher energy level.
